For lift contractors and engineers, the Code is the benchmark for professional excellence. It shifts the industry focus from simply "making it work" to "proving it is safe." The rigorous documentation, testing protocols, and commissioning procedures mandated by the Code raise the professional standard of the workforce. Finally, for the authorities, the Code provides a clear, legal framework for enforcement, allowing inspectors to objectively assess compliance during commissioning and periodic examinations.
